Abstract PROBLEM TO BE SOLVED: To provide an information processing apparatus configured to improve touch input accuracy by use of a result detected by a touch sensor, and to provide a display control method, and a display control program.SOLUTION: An information processing apparatus includes: a display unit 70 having a screen; a touch sensor unit arranged in the screen and having a sensor surface; and a control unit 46 which calculates a position in the sensor surface corresponding to a link object displayed on the screen and a distance between the sensor surface and a non-contact object, in accordance with a result detected by the touch sensor unit, to temporarily stop drawing update of a predetermined range including the link object, in the screen, when the distance is equal to or larger than a threshold.SELECTED DRAWING: Figure 3 【課題】タッチセンサの検出結果を用いてタッチ入力の精度を向上させることができる情報処理装置、表示制御方法および表示制御プログラムを提供する。【解決手段】情報処理装置は、画面を有する表示部70と、画面に設けられ、センサ面を有するタッチセンサ部と、前記タッチセンサ部の検出結果に応じて、画面に表示されたリンクオブジェクトに対応するセンサ面の箇所と、センサ面と非接触の物体との距離を算出し、距離が閾値以内である場合に、画面においてリンクオブジェクトを含む所定範囲の描画更新を一時的に停止する制御を行う制御部46と、を備える。【選択図】図3
